Dear community,
On behalf of the Nova Bonita and Nova Orchestra development teams, I
have the pleasure to announce today the next major Milestone release
for those open source projects. Milestone 3 represents a significant
step forward for “Nova” technology including the stabilization of the
common and generic engine leveraged in both projects (the Process
Virtual Machine
<http://www.onjava.com/pub/a/onjava/2007/05/07/the-process-virtual-machine.html>)
as well as advanced features added to both XPDL (Bonita) and BPEL
(Orchestra) extensions.
Milestone 3 is also a perfect example of a successful collaboration
between leading open source communities: Bull, OW2 Consortium and
Jboss/Redhat, working together in PVM core engine, modules and services.
Major improvements added in this milestone release are:
- The Process Virtual Machine: integration of the 1.0.alpha1 release
of this generic framework at both Nova Bonita and Nova Orchestra
projects. The PVM has been refactored to easily fit with process
languages extensions requirements. Advanced PVM services such
persistence or timers have been added to this first release.
- Nova Bonita: native XPDL support based on the PVM xml parsing
utilities and a generic mechanism to handle activities extensions,
Workflow API’s separation between deployment, definition, running and
history data, advanced operations such suspend and resume for manual
activities, reworked activity life cycle between activities and tasks
or support for both standard (JSE) and enterprise (JEE) environments…
For a complete description of features coming with this M3 please
visit Nova Bonita releases notes
<http://forge.objectweb.org/project/shownotes.php?release_id=2544>
- Nova Orchestra: added support for asynchronous BPEL statements based
on the PVM timer service: pick and wait, sequential mode support for
ForEach BPEL statement, persistent vs in memory modes execution (based
on the PVM persistence framework, hibernate as default
implementation), basic BPEL static analysis…

Following our Open Source collaboration spirit, next Milestone (M4)
will come with a new BPM graphical console for Nova Bonita and Nova
Orchestra. This console will be based on the ultimate version of the
eXo Platform open source project. Together with this console we will
continue to leverage the integration we did in the past between Bonita
and eXo ECM.
Note that as eXo is based on portlets, so the BPM Console will easily
allow to add your favourite portlets or new features on top.
The BPM console will provide deployment, execution and monitoring BPM
capabilities. It could be deployed individually or in common with Nova
Bonita and/or Nova Orchestra projects. Could you imagine a Web 2.0
generic and customizable console for easily handle XPDL and/or BPEL
processes? Stay tuned, next M4 will be released soon !
